1. What are the 3 P's? - Correct Answer: perceive, process, predict
2. What is the max recommended length for RG-6? - Correct Answer: 150ft
3. What is the max recommended length for RG-11? - Correct Answer:
250ft
4. What does DB measure? - Correct Answer: loss
5. What is DBMV - Correct Answer: a final absolute level at a point
6. Loss of 100' of RG-6 at 750mhz - Correct Answer: 5.5db
7. Loss of 100' of RG-11 at 750mhz - Correct Answer: 3.6db
8. What does RX stand for? - Correct Answer: receive power
,9. What does RX measure? - Correct Answer: Downstream/Forward
10.What does TX mean? - Correct Answer: transmit power
11.What does TX measure? - Correct Answer: Upstream/Return
12.What voltage must be guarded? - Correct Answer: 50 Volts

20.What is a open? - Correct Answer: A problem characterized by one or
more telephones that will not work, one or both conductors have been cut
21.What is a dirty open? - Correct Answer: intermittent noise on the line
and or temporary outages, one or both conductors have been partially cut
22.What is cross talk? - Correct Answer: Two lines that have indundance
caused by twisted pairs that are in close proximity to another line you can
hear conversations from the other line
23.What is reverse polarity? - Correct Answer: TPTP is reversed
24.What is a short circuit? - Correct Answer: Two crossing wires with bare
wire that are touching and conducting
25.What is split pairs? - Correct Answer: line 1 and line 2 are reversed. L1
Blue lands on L2 Orange
